A former KPMG partner has settled charges from the SEC on the audit of Xerox.
Joseph Boyle, 62, has accepted a one-year ban on auditing public companies, a settlement that involved no admission or denial of wrongdoing.
The settlement comes eight months after KPMG agreed to pay $22.5m over its audit of Xerox.
Xerox had overstated its financial results by $1.5bn over four years.
